Match Context
Bangladesh and Pakistan are set for the second T20I of their three-match series at the Shere Bangla National Stadium in Dhaka. The home side took a crucial 7-wicket win in the first match, with Parvez Hossain Emon (56) and Towhid Hridoy (36) anchoring the chase against a struggling Pakistan batting lineup that collapsed to 110 in the 19th over.
The series is part of both teams' preparations for the 2025 Asia Cup and the 2026 Men's T20 World Cup. With Pakistan missing key stars such as Babar Azam and Mohammad Rizwan, they will be looking to build momentum with their younger squad. Bangladesh, on the other hand, are riding high on home advantage and a strong recent performance.

Pitch and Playing Conditions
The Shere Bangla Stadium is known for its slow, spinning surface, which often favors the second batting side. While fast bowlers may get some early movement, the pitch tends to assist spinners as the game progresses. Batters who can consolidate and rotate the strike will have the upper hand.
